One of the most frequent issues that can arise with uPVC windows is that they become difficult to lock or open. This problem usually occurs when the locking mechanism has become stiff or jammed. If this is the case, a quick fix is to apply graphite powder or machine oil to lubricate the handle and lock mechanism. This will let the mechanism free up and the window or door to function normal again.

Another issue that can be found with upvc window repairs windows is that the hinges can become stiff or even stuck. This problem is commonly caused by grit and dust building up on the hinges with time. Lubricating the hinges with grease or oil is the solution. If you use the wrong oil, however, could lead to damage and may render the hinges inoperable.

Repairs to stained glass

Stained glass windows are beautiful features in homes, churches and other buildings. They can add visual interest, privacy and light to an area. However, they are fragile and must be carefully maintained to ensure they remain in good working order. Even with the best care, stained and lead glass windows can deteriorate over time due to age and exposure to weather and other environmental elements. This can lead to cracks, fading, and water leakage. If you have a stained or leaded glass window that requires repair, it is essential to locate a local expert who can restore the glass to its original splendor.

On average, the cost of fixing broken or cracked stained glass is about $500. The exact price will depend on the kind of solution required to fix the problem. For instance professional technicians may use copper foil or epoxy edge-gluing to repair the broken glass. They can also relead lead cames and repair stained glass. There are several alternatives each having its own advantages and costs. The best solution will be determined by the size of the crack, its location, and the type of material used to create the glass.

Leaded glass cracks could be caused by thermal expansion, vibrations or contraction and building movements, or just normal wear and tear. As time passes, cracks can expand and cause more problems. To prevent further damage and growth the crack that crosses an important part of a stained-glass panel or the face must be repaired as soon as is possible. Years ago, this was typically done by splicing in the "Dutchman" lead flange over the crack. This technique was a poor solution, and now there are more effective methods to repair these kinds of cracks.

Stained glass restoration can take various varieties. It can be as easy as fixing cracks, or as difficult as restoring an entire stained glass window or door panel to its original form. In general, the price of a full restoration is higher than the cost of a simple repair. The job involves cleaning and removing damaged glass, tightening lead cames, sealing the cement and re-tying it, and re-installing stained glass pieces that are missing.

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ping prevents water and air from coming into homes through the gaps around windows and doors. It's a crucial part of home maintenance and can reduce the need for costly repairs or bills for energy, as well making a home more comfortable. However, the materials used to make the seal may degrade as time passes due to wear and tear, which makes it important to replace the seals from time to time.

You can detect whether your weather stripping has been damaged by noticing a spot that is wet after washing the windows, a whistling sound while driving or a draft you feel inside an unlocked door. These are all signs that it's time for a Tasker who can provide repair for weatherstripping near me.

Taskers can seal your windows and door by using a variety of weatherstripping materials. Foam tapes are composed of open-cell or closed cell foam. They are available in a variety of sizes, thicknesses, and widths. They are simple to install and are easily cut using scissors. Felt strips are also affordable and usually last for about a year or two. They can be cut into lengths using scissors and then attach them to the frame of your door, hinge side, or sliding window using staples, glue, or tacks. Vinyl or metal V-strips are somewhat more difficult to install however they can be nailed in the window jamb.

One of the most common issues that occur with double-paned windows is fogging of the glass. The airtight seal between the two panes has a problem. Depending on the cause of the leak, it might be possible to correct the issue by sealing the window. If the window has been exposed for a prolonged period of time to elements, it might be necessary replace the entire unit.
